AI Technical Summary
Projectors are prone to attracting dust during the heat dissipation process, resulting in poor projection quality. Existing technologies struggle to find a balance between heat dissipation and dust prevention.
The system employs a combination of medium- and high-efficiency filters and a fan. The medium- and high-efficiency filters are installed in the second receiving cavity, and the fan draws gas from the first receiving cavity, which then passes through the medium- and high-efficiency filters before entering the first receiving cavity, ensuring that the gas is clean and effectively dissipates heat.
This technology effectively prevents dust from entering the projector while simultaneously dissipating heat, thus improving projection quality and extending the lifespan of the device.

TECHNICAL FIELD
[0001] The utility model relates to projection technology field, especially a kind of projector. BACKGROUND
[0002] High-power light source and spatial light modulator are built-in projector, on the one hand, a large amount of heat will inevitably be generated, on the other hand, precise spatial light modulator cannot work at too high temperature, so projector needs better heat dissipation system.For this reason, in the related art, fan is used to blow air into projector to cool down, but this will make more dust in projector, dust will block projection light path, affect projection effect.Therefore, a kind of projector with good heat dissipation but better projection effect is needed. [0053] The projection assembly 12 is a component of the projector 10 for modulating light into projection light and projecting the projection light. It usually comprises a light source, a light modulator and a lens. Please refer to Figure 6 and Figure 10 In the embodiments shown in Figure 6 and Figure 10 , the projection assembly 12 comprises a light source 121, a condenser cup 125, a spatial light modulator 124, a reflecting plate 126 and a lens group 127; the light source 121 generates available light, the condenser cup 125 shapes the light of the light source 121 into incident light of the spatial light modulator 124; the spatial light modulator 124 loads image information into its outgoing light; the reflecting plate 126 reflects the projection light with image information to be incident on the lens group 127; and the lens group 127 finally projects the light with image information out of the projector 10 to form a projection image. In some embodiments, the lens group 127 can be focused so that the projection image can be formed on a projection surface at different distances from the projector 10.
[0054] In some other embodiments, the projection assembly 12 can be of other configurations. In one example, the projector can employ a reflective spatial light modulator; and can be provided with a combiner, and the light source can generate three colors of light, the spatial light modulator modulates different colors of light respectively, and the combiner combines the modulated three colors of light and finally inputs the light into the lens group to project the projector.
[0055] The first accommodating cavity 111 and the second accommodating cavity 131 are communicated, so that the fan 15 arranged in the first accommodating cavity 111 can draw air from the second accommodating cavity 131 and send it into the first accommodating cavity 111. The fan can be an axial fan, a cross-flow fan, a centrifugal fan, etc.
[0056] The medium-high efficiency filter screen 14 is a gas filter screen, which can be a high efficiency particulate air (HEPA) filter screen, a sub-HEPA filter screen or a medium efficiency filter screen. The medium-high efficiency filter screen 14 has good filtering effect on gas and high filtering efficiency, so as to ensure low air suction resistance and large air intake, to ensure heat dissipation of the projector 10 and avoid large particles from entering the projector 10, especially to effectively avoid particles with a diameter of 2.5 μm or more from entering the projector 10. In this way, there is no particulate matter in the projector 10 to hinder the projection of light, so as to improve the projection effect of the projector 10.

[0067] The first end wall 112 can be a bottom wall or a top wall of the first shell 11. When the first end wall 112 is a bottom wall of the first shell, the second end wall 133 is a bottom wall of the second shell 13; when the first end wall 112 is a top wall of the first shell 11, the second end wall 133 is a top wall of the second shell 13.
[0068] Since the various components of the projection assembly 12 can be installed on the first end wall 112 within the first receiving cavity 111, the surface area of the first end wall 112 is often the largest surface area of the wall on the first housing 11. The second housing 13, located on one side of the first end wall 112, can have a larger mounting area, or in other words, the second receiving cavity 131 can have a larger bottom area. The mounting cavity 1331 is recessed into the second receiving cavity 131, therefore the second receiving cavity 131 has a larger bottom area, and the mounting cavity 1331 can also have a larger bottom area. The medium-high efficiency filter 14 is typically plate-shaped, and the large bottom area of the mounting cavity 1331 allows for the installation of a larger medium-high efficiency filter 14. The filtration resistance of the medium-high efficiency filter 14 is negatively correlated with its surface area. Therefore, this arrangement can increase the surface area of the medium-high efficiency filter 14, thereby reducing the filtration resistance, increasing the air intake into the first receiving cavity 111, and improving the heat dissipation efficiency of the projector 10.

[0074] Please refer to Figure 4 and Figure 7 In some embodiments, an air inlet 1121 communicating with the second receiving cavity 131 is provided on the first end wall 112; the medium and high efficiency filter 14 is plate-shaped, and on a projection surface parallel to the medium and high efficiency filter 14, the projection of the air inlet 1121 onto the projection surface is outside the projection of the air intake cavity 136 onto the projection surface.
[0075] In one example, namely Figure 4 On the projection surface shown, along Figure 4 Projecting in the direction of the middle arrow onto the projection plane shown by the dotted line, the projection of the air inlet 1121 is outside the projection of the intake chamber 136. This arrangement ensures that the air inlet 1121 is not directly opposite the intake chamber 136, and thus not directly opposite the medium-efficiency filter 14. It is known that the negative pressure is greatest at the air inlet 1121. By preventing the air inlet 1121 from being directly opposite the medium-efficiency filter 14, a large pressure gradient is avoided on the plane containing the medium-efficiency filter 14. This ensures that the negative pressure is basically the same throughout the medium-efficiency filter 14, thus utilizing the filtration capacity of the medium-efficiency filter 14 more evenly. This reduces the rate at which the filtration resistance increases with usage time, thereby extending the service life of the medium-efficiency filter 14.

[0081] Please refer to Figure 6 and Figure 7 In some embodiments, the fan 15 comprises a centrifugal fan 151 and an axial fan 152; the centrifugal fan 151 and the axial fan 152 are arranged in the first accommodating cavity 111; the centrifugal fan 151 is used to suck the gas from the second accommodating cavity 131 into the first accommodating cavity 111; and the axial fan 152 is used to push the gas in the first accommodating cavity 111 out of the first accommodating cavity 111.
[0082] The centrifugal fan 151 has high air extraction capacity, and is arranged in the upper air area in the first accommodating cavity 111 to ensure sufficient air flow into the first accommodating cavity 111. The axial fan 152 has a large air inlet area, and can easily absorb stray air flow in the first accommodating cavity 111 to ensure that the high-temperature air after heat exchange can be discharged from the projector 10, thereby improving the heat dissipation capacity of the projector 10.
[0083] Please refer to Figure 7 and Figure 10 In some embodiments, the projection assembly 12 includes a light source 121, a heat conduction member 122 and a heat dissipation fin 123 arranged in the first accommodating cavity 111. One end of the heat conduction member 122 is in heat conduction connection with the light source 121, and the other end is in heat conduction connection with the heat dissipation fin 123. The axial fan 152 is used to transport air to the heat dissipation fin 123, so that the air is discharged from the projector 10 after passing through the heat dissipation fin 123.
[0084] The heat conduction member 122 is a device with good heat conduction, for example, it can be a metal or an alloy with good heat conduction, etc., and can also be a heat pipe, or a combination of multiple heat conduction devices, for example Figure 10 In the embodiment shown, the heat conduction member 122 is a combination of a heated block and a heat pipe. The heated block uniformly transmits the heat of the light source 121 to the heat pipe, and the heat pipe transmits the heat to the heat dissipation fin 123 or directly dissipates to the air. At this time, the axial fan 152 can transport air to the heat dissipation fin 123, so that the heat dissipated by the heat dissipation fin 123 and the heat pipe to the air is discharged from the projector 10, thereby improving the heat dissipation capacity of the projector 10.
[0085] The heat conduction connection refers to direct or indirect connection. In one example, the light source 121 is in direct contact with the heat conduction member 122 for heat conduction connection. In another example, the light source 121 and the heat conduction member 122 are coated with heat-conducting silicone for heat conduction connection. The heat dissipation fin 123 and the heat conduction member 122 can also be in direct or indirect heat conduction connection.
[0086] Since the axial fan 152 is arranged in the lower air area in the first accommodating cavity 111, and the light source 121 is a device with a large heat generation in the projector 10, the air for heat dissipation of the light source 121 in the lower air area in the first accommodating cavity 111 and directly discharged from the first accommodating cavity 111 helps to protect other devices in the first accommodating cavity 111 from overheating.

[0095] Please refer to Figure 6 , Figure 7 and Figure 9In some embodiments, the spatial light modulator 124 comprises a Fresnel lens 1242, an LCD panel 1243 and a polarizing panel 1244 arranged in sequence and parallel to each other, and a central air duct 1241 is formed between the Fresnel lens 1242 and the LCD panel 1243 and between the LCD panel 1243 and the polarizing panel 1244.
[0096] The polarizing panel 1244 and the LCD panel 1243 both absorb part of the light of the light source 121, thereby generating heat, and the LCD panel 1243 can further comprise TFTs (thin film transistors) which also generate heat. The liquid crystal material in the LCD and the polarizing panel 1244 are both easily damaged at high temperatures, and therefore the central air duct 1241 formed between the Fresnel lens 1242 and the LCD panel 1243 and between the LCD panel 1243 and the polarizing panel 1244 can directly dissipate heat for the LCD panel 1243 and the polarizing panel 1244, thereby avoiding overheating of the LCD panel 1243 and the polarizing panel 1244 and prolonging the service life of the LCD panel 1243 and the polarizing panel 1244.
